How to Effectively Repurpose Your Webinar Content
Tuesday, January 18, 2022

Educational webinars are one of the most effective forms of marketing for generating leads, promoting your business and its employees, and boosting conversions for professional service organizations.

But once the webinar is over your work is far from over. In fact that is where the greatest opportunities are.

Smart marketers find creative ways to extend the life of their webinars and make use of all the valuable content that was generated from it in order to engage with attendees, those who registered who couldn’t make it and others who might be interested in the content who didn’t know about it.

The solution is all about repurposing it in creative ways.

By repurposing your webinar content, you provide your audience with multiple ways to consume the content while giving yourself more opportunities to reach prospects.

Here are 10 effective ways to repurpose your webinars into great content and extend their shelf life.

First things first – make sure you have a transcript of your webinar.

This is going to make your life so much easier as you create new content from your webinar.

Then go through your transcript and pick out important topics on which to focus as well as speaker sound bites.

You can repurpose your webinar content into:

  1. a podcast with the webinar’s speakers expanding on the topic

  2. blog posts – your webinar can easily be turned into blog copy

  3. a white paper or ebook (expand on the webinar’s topic)

  4. social media video clips (splice up the full recording into short segments – less than 3 mins and post on social/YouTube

  5. speaker quotes, statistics and examples from your webinar are all great inspiration from which you can create graphics

  6. email campaign funnel copy (use the video segments and blog posts)

  7. FAQ content – answer attendee questions in a social and blog post

  8. A Slideshare presentation (will help enhance your SEO)

  9. infographics illustrating the webinar’s key points

  10. conference topic – you have the slides and did a dry run, so submit to speak at major conferences in your industry

And here are some ideas to turn your webinar content into blog posts:

  • How-to or list posts: Expand on a topic from the webinar in educational posts

  • Digest posts: Summarize the webinar in a post and include links to additional relevant resources

  • Infographic posts: Use data shared in the webinar to create informational posts.

  • Quote compilation post: Compile the best speaker quotes into a roundup piece
